S.C. BOCES and the Hudson Valley DDSO presents Sullivan County Autism Awareness Day on Saturday October 9th at the Seelig Theatre at Sullivan County Community College.
The keynote address will be given by Alyson Beytein, an international speaker and mother of three sons with autism. Ms. Beytein is also a columnist for "Autism Spectrum Quarterly" and the host of web-radio program called "Family to Family" on AutismOne.org. The keynote address will begin at 8:30 a.m.
Registration is $25 per person, or free if you are the parent of a child being educated in Sullivan County. Refreshments will be served, and child care will be provided by staff from SullivanArc, a not-for-profit agency that provides supports and services for individuals with intellectual and/or developmental disabilities.
